Welcome to the 2022 Connecticut Flex Series!
The goal of the series is to provide players of all skill levels with the opportunity to play shorter PDGA sanctioned events throughout Connecticut. Any proceeds generated by the series will be used to support other tournaments being run within the state. Whether you are an experienced Pro or never played a tournament before, the Connecticut Flex Series is for you!

FEES:
$25 per player broken down as follows:
- $2 to the PDGA
- $2 to the End of Season payout/prizes/trophies for that division
- $7 for greens fees to Tower Ridge
- $14 to the payout (Pros) or player pack (AM’s)
There is a $10 one day membership fee for anyone not currently a PDGA member.
Effective for 2022: Please remember that in order to receive cash at a PDGA event in a Pro division, the player must have a PDGA number (current or expired)
LAYOUT:
All divisions will play the currently marked Blue (middle) layout for this event. Course notes will be sent out prior to the event and available at check in.
TEE TIMES:
During registration, players will select a tee time window. Due to the nature of the Tower Ridge property, we will be assigning tee times for this event. Tee times will be assigned within the hour you select at registration.
CHECK IN:
Tournament central for this event will be located in the course Pro Shop. Players must check in prior to their tee time.
AWARDS/PRIZES:
Division winners will be awarded a trophy after the event. There is no awards ceremony and you do not need to stay after completing your round.
All players are automatically entered into a $100 Ace Pot.
There will be at least one CTP that all players will be eligible to win.
As a way to encourage PDGA growth, we will award a PDGA membership to the lowest scoring player at the event that has not previously been registered with the PDGA.
